%3A%20%E5%AE%9A%E7%BE%A9%E6%B8%88%E3%81%BF%E3%81%AE%E3%83%95%E3%82%A9%E3%83%AB%E3%83%80%E3%83%BC%E6%A7%8B%E9%80%A0%E3%82%92%E4%BD%9C%E6%88%90%E3%81%99%E3%82%8B.png)
Windows の右クリック メニューから起動して、定義済みのフォルダー構造を作成するスクリプトを作成することは可能ですか?
職場で新しい更新が行われるたびに、フォルダー内に新しい「更新レコード」を作成する必要があります。各更新フォルダーには、ほぼ同じフォルダーが含まれています。
毎回コピーできる空のフォルダー構造を作成することはできますが、古い CSV リポジトリを使用しているため、奇妙な参照または ID が付与され、フォルダーまたはファイルの複数のコピーを分離するのに問題があるため、新しいフォルダーとファイルを作成する必要があります。
もう 1 つの問題は、私の仕事用ラップトップが「管理者制限」されているため、プログラムをインストールする権限がないことですが、スクリプト (残念ながら、アクティブ化されていないため PowerShell は実行できません) とマクロは実行できます。
それが可能かどうかはわかりませんが、ボタンをクリックするだけで新しいフォルダー構造を作成できれば、本当に時間の節約になります。
乾杯、
- メスティカ
答え1
この bat ファイルを試してください (コードをメモ帳に貼り付けて、.bat ファイルとして保存します)。最初の行は変数なので、すべてを作成するルート フォルダーに変更します。
set rootDirectory = C:\Documents and Settings\username\Desktop\
cd %rootDirectory%
md test
md test\01
上記では、デスクトップに 1 つのフォルダー (test という名前) が作成され、その後に 01 というサブフォルダーが作成されます。
編集
実際、このインスタンスでも変数は必要ありません (これはまったく同じことを行いますが、コードが 1 行少なくなります)。
cd C:\Documents and Settings\username\Desktop\
md test
md test\01